Rep. Butterfield Introduces Bill to Recognize Haliwa-Saponi Indian Tribe of N.C.
WASHINGTON, Dec. 19 -- Rep. G.K. Butterfield, D-N.C., has introduced legislation (H.R. 9536) to "extend Federal recognition to the Haliwa-Saponi Indian Tribe of North Carolina." The bill was introduced on Dec. 14. It was referred to the House Natural Resources Committee. For more information, Rep. G.K. Rep. Hudson Introduces Bill to Improve Patient Access to Health Care Services
WASHINGTON, Dec. 21 -- Rep. Richard Hudson, R-N.C., has introduced legislation (H.R. 9584) to "improve patient access to health care services and provide improved medical care by reducing the excessive burden the liability system places on the health care delivery system." The bill was introduced on Dec. 15 and was co-sponsored by Rep. J. Luis Correa, D-Calif. It was jointly referred to the House Judiciary and Energy and Commerce committees. For more information, Rep.
